Spice-Rubbed Chicken with Israeli Couscous
from Martha Stewart's Food Everyday
for one
2 1/2 t. olive oil
1/4 c. Israeli couscous
1 garlic clove, minced
salt and pepper
2 c. fresh baby spinach
1 T. sliced almonds (i used cashews cuz thats what we had - yummy)
1 chicken breast
1 1/2 t. garam masala
In saucepan, heat 1/2 t. oil over medium. Add couscous, cook, stirring, until lightly toasted, 1-2 minutes. Add 1/2 c. water and garlic; season with salt and pepper. Bring to boil; cover, and reduce heat to low. Cook until liquid is almost absorbed, about 6 minutes. Add spinach, and cook until couscous is tender, 1 minute. Stir in nuts, set aside.
Sprinkle chicken with garam masala; season with salt and pepper. In a small skillet over medium-low, heat 2 t. oil. Add chicken; cook until opaque throughout, 6-8 minutes per side.
